Vishal and Sameera Reddy’s thirty kisses

Actor Vishal must be one of the luckiest guys in K’town. He got at least thirty kisses from dusky babe Sameera Reddy and in turn he kissed her only ten times less than that number.

Before you let your imagination run away with you, we are talking about a certain bathroom scene in a crucial segment of their upcoming flick Vedi directed by Prabhu Deva.

“It’s not a forced scene in the film. It’s very much there in the original Tollywood version, Souriyam,” explained the actor.

We hear that Sameera did 30 retakes for this sensuous scene! Vishal has a convincing reason for this.

“Oh yeah, basically the Mumbai heroines have language problems when they come to the Tamil film biz. There were a few humorous dialogues which were a part of the scene. Each time she was kissing me, she was forgetting the dialogues and when she did say the lines perfectly, the kiss went for a toss! In the process, she ended up kissing me on my cheeks thirty times,” he laughs.

Vishal adds, “The director went in for a variety of different-angled shots and finally he’ll keep only the best on the editing table.”

On opting for Prabhu Deva as director, Vishal said, “His track record with remakes is really good. He has a knack of projecting his heroes in a stylish way and his sense of humour is amazing. You can see touches of his original humour in Vedi.”

After Sandakozhi, Vishal says that he will be seen in an angry young man role.

“After shocking the audience with Avan Ivan, I deliberately chose this script, which is a wholesome family entertainer. The movie, which is scheduled for a September 29 release, will be a visual treat,” the actor assures confidently.

Trisha says yes to Vishal

Vishal is feeling sprightly these days.

The reason — the actor has finally succeeded in getting Trisha for his next untitled film, which will be directed by Thiru.

Apparently, Vishal has been pursuing Trisha right from the Sathyam days. He was enthusiastic about casting Trisha in Sathyam and the actress even accepted an advance for the film, when in an unexpected turn of events, Nayanthara was signed for the film.

Later, Vishal tried once again to rope in Trisha for Thoranai but on that occasion Trisha could not dole out the needed dates. When Thiru, who made Theeradha Vilayattu Pillai with Vishal, wanted to cast the Vinnai Thaandi Varauvaaya star as one of the three heroines, she turned down the project as she did not want to be part of a multi-heroine subject.

Even the Avan Ivan actor approached Trisha for his next offering Vedi (which he is doing with Sameera) and the director of the film Prabhu Deva was also keen to get her on board. But sources said that she refused on the grounds that it was not a meaty role.

Now, the buzz is that, at last, the tall actor finally managed to convince the lady to agree to star in his forthcoming film with Thiru.

The film has Yuvan Shankar Raja providing the music. Sources reveal that it was the mind-blowing script which lured Trisha into saying ‘yes’ to the project.

Insiders tell us that Trisha was keeping a low profile after the recent marriage controversy. Looks as though the Mankatha actress is in no mood to get hitched and is busy listening to scripts from top directors.
